    How to Roll a Wrap

    Wraps are a quick, delicious, and versatile meal option that you can customize with your favorite ingredients. However, if not rolled properly, they can fall apart or become messy to eat. Learning how to roll a wrap correctly helps keep everything in place and makes your meal more enjoyable. With the right technique, you can create neat, secure wraps every time.

      Choose the Right Wrap and Fillings

    Start by selecting a soft tortilla or flatbread that is flexible and fresh. This makes it easier to roll without tearing.

    Avoid overfilling, as too many ingredients can make rolling difficult.

    • Use fresh, soft wraps
    • Choose balanced fillings
    • Avoid adding too much
    1. Warm the Wrap Slightly

    Warming the wrap makes it more flexible and less likely to crack.

    You can heat it briefly in a pan or microwave for a few seconds.

    • Heat for a short time
    • Avoid overheating
    • Keep it soft and pliable
    1. Place Fillings in the Center

    Lay the wrap flat and place your fillings slightly below the center in a horizontal line.

    This position helps you roll it tightly and evenly.

    • Keep fillings in the middle
    • Leave space at the edges
    • Arrange ingredients evenly
    1. Fold the Sides Inward

    Before rolling, fold the left and right sides of the wrap toward the center.

    This step helps keep the fillings from spilling out.

    • Fold both sides evenly
    • Hold fillings in place
    • Keep the wrap tight
    1. Roll Tightly from the Bottom

    Start rolling from the bottom edge, tucking the fillings in as you go. Roll firmly but gently until the wrap is fully closed.

    A tight roll ensures the wrap stays together.

    • Roll slowly and evenly
    • Keep pressure consistent
    • Secure the final edge
